Industrial distributors kept up the furious pace of merger and acquisition activity in November, as companies seeking to increase their profits and geographic footprints snapped up other companies.

In one of the largest transactions, Baldor Electric Co., the Ft. Smith, Ark.-based manufacturer of electric motors, drives and generators, agreed to pay $1.8 billion for the Rockwell unit, which makes Reliance Electric and Dodge brand electric motors, bearings and gears.

The deal gives Baldor about $1 billion in higher-margin revenues, a manufacturing base in China, and extends its product line into power transmission products and larger motors.
